Autumnal colors,
Russet and red,
Draped in a cape,
That covers her head.
She tucks inside,
The golden locks of hair,
Her mama told her,
To never bare.
A mist forms around her, ever so,
There, in the forest, unafraid, though.
They envelop her,
In a magical dance,
She smiles, happily,
This is not happenstance.
Knowing it is they,
Who come to call,
Every November,
Near the end of fall.
And this child awaits, ever patiently, their arrival,
For she counts on them, for her very survival…

Oh Hi! Hello there, let me introduce myself!
Please, don’t confuse me with the one on a shelf
I’d much rather be, where lies the green grass
I fancy my time, sitting here, on my… butt
The light, it draws sweetness, closer to me
I’m so very happy, watching a lantern fairy
I love how she dances, around, in the night
Sparkling brightly, underneath the starlight
So if you have a moment, or two, to spare
Come sit for a while, I’m happy to share
This place I call home, though fancy, it’s not
But, I’m sure you’ll enjoy it, ’cause I sure do, a lot!
Oh dear, did I forget, to tell you my name?
Why it’s Jed, this is true, I must proclaim.
